
H. B. 4377



(By Delegate Paxton)



[Introduced February 4, 2002; referred to the



Committee on Education then Finance.]
A BILL to amend and reenact section eight-a, article four, chapter
eighteen-a of the code of West Virginia, one thousand nine
hundred thirty-one, as amended, relating to
increasing school
service personnel employees by one pay grade after ten years
of employment; and providing that employees in the top pay
grade will receive an increase of thirty dollars per month
after ten years of employment.
Be it enacted by the Legislature of West Virginia:

That section eight-a, article four, chapter eighteen-a of the
code of West Virginia, one thousand nine hundred thirty-one, as
amended, be amended and reenacted to read as follows:
ARTICLE 4. SALARIES, WAGES AND OTHER BENEFITS.
§18A-4-8a. Service personnel minimum monthly salaries.

(1) The minimum monthly pay for each service employee whose
employment is for a period of more than three and one-half hours a
day shall be at least the amounts indicated in the "state minimum
pay scale pay grade I" and the minimum monthly pay for each service
employee whose employment is for a period of three and one-half
hours or less a day shall be at least one-half the amount indicated
in the "state minimum pay scale pay grade I" set forth in this
section: Provided, That beginning the first day of the second
quarter of the employment term in the school year two thousand
one--two thousand two the minimum monthly pay for each service
employee whose employment is for a period of more than three and
one-half hours a day shall be at least the amounts indicated in the
"state minimum pay scale pay grade II" and the minimum monthly pay
for each service employee whose employment is for a period of three
and one-half hours or less a day shall be at least one-half the
amount indicated in the "state minimum pay scale pay grade II" set
forth in this section.

(2) An additional ten dollars per month shall be added to the
minimum monthly pay of each service employee who holds a high
school diploma or its equivalent: Provided, That effective the
first day of July, two thousand one, an additional twelve dollars
per month shall be added to the minimum monthly pay of each service
employee who holds a high school diploma or its equivalent.

(3) An additional ten dollars per month also shall be added to
the minimum monthly pay of each service employee for each of the
following:

(A) A service employee who holds twelve college hours or
comparable credit obtained in a trade or vocational school as
approved by the state board;

(B) A service employee who holds twenty-four college hours or comparable credit obtained in a trade or vocational school as
approved by the state board;

(C) A service employee who holds thirty-six college hours or
comparable credit obtained in a trade or vocational school as
approved by the state board;

(D) A service employee who holds forty-eight college hours or
comparable credit obtained in a trade or vocational school as
approved by the state board;

(E) A service employee who holds sixty college hours or
comparable credit obtained in a trade or vocational school as
approved by the state board;

(F) A service employee who holds seventy-two college hours or
comparable credit obtained in a trade or vocational school as
approved by the state board;

(G) Effective the first day of July, two thousand one, a
service employee who holds eighty-four college hours or comparable
credit obtained in a trade or vocational school as approved by the
state board;

(H) Effective the first day of July, two thousand one, a
service employee who holds ninety-six college hours or comparable
credit obtained in a trade or vocational school as approved by the state board;

(I) Effective the first day of July, two thousand one, a
service employee who holds one hundred eight college hours or
comparable credit obtained in a trade or vocational school as
approved by the state board;

(J) Effective the first day of July, two thousand one, a
service employee who holds one hundred twenty college hours or
comparable credit obtained in a trade or vocational school as
approved by the state board;

(K) Effective the first day of July, two thousand one, a
service employee who holds a bachelor's degree; and

(L) Effective the first day of July, two thousand one, a
service employee who holds a master's degree.

(4) When any part of a school service employee's daily shift
of work is performed between the hours of six o'clock p.m. and five
o'clock a.m. the following day, the employee shall be paid no less
than an additional ten dollars per month and one half of the pay
shall be paid with local funds.

(5) Any service employee required to work on any legal school
holiday shall be paid at a rate one and one-half times the
employee's usual hourly rate.

(6) Any full-time service personnel required to work in excess
of their normal working day during any week which contains a school
holiday for which they are paid shall be paid for the additional
hours or fraction of the additional hours at a rate of one and
one-half times their usual hourly rate and paid entirely from
county board funds.

(7) No service employee may have his or her daily work
schedule changed during the school year without the employee's
written consent and the employee's required daily work hours may
not be changed to prevent the payment of time and one-half wages or
the employment of another employee.

(8) The minimum hourly rate of pay for extra duty assignments
as defined in section eight-b of this article shall be no less than
one seventh of the employee's daily total salary for each hour the
employee is involved in performing the assignment and paid entirely
from local funds: Provided, That an alternative minimum hourly
rate of pay for performing extra duty assignments within a
particular category of employment may be utilized if the alternate
hourly rate of pay is approved both by the county board and by the
affirmative vote of a two-thirds majority of the regular full-time
employees within that classification category of employment within that county: Provided, however, That the vote shall be by secret
ballot if requested by a service personnel employee within that
classification category within that county. The salary for any
fraction of an hour the employee is involved in performing the
assignment shall be prorated accordingly. When performing extra
duty assignments, employees who are regularly employed on a
one-half day salary basis shall receive the same hourly extra duty
assignment pay computed as though the employee were employed on a
full-day salary basis.

(9) The minimum pay for any service personnel employees
engaged in the removal of asbestos material or related duties
required for asbestos removal shall be their regular total daily
rate of pay and no less than an additional three dollars per hour
or no less than five dollars per hour for service personnel
supervising asbestos removal responsibilities for each hour these
employees are involved in asbestos related duties. Related duties
required for asbestos removal include, but are not limited to,
travel, preparation of the work site, removal of asbestos
decontamination of the work site, placing and removal of equipment
and removal of structures from the site. If any member of an
asbestos crew is engaged in asbestos related duties outside of the employee's regular employment county, the daily rate of pay shall
be no less than the minimum amount as established in the employee's
regular employment county for asbestos removal and an additional
thirty dollars per each day the employee is engaged in asbestos
removal and related duties. The additional pay for asbestos
removal and related duties shall be payable entirely from county
funds. Before service personnel employees may be utilized in the
removal of asbestos material or related duties, they shall have
completed a federal Environmental Protection Act approved training
program and be licensed. The employer shall provide all necessary
protective equipment and maintain all records required by the
Environmental Protection Act.

(10) For the purpose of qualifying for additional pay as
provided in section eight, article five of this chapter, an aide
shall be considered to be exercising the authority of a supervisory
aide and control over pupils if the aide is required to supervise,
control, direct, monitor, escort or render service to a child or
children when not under the direct supervision of certificated
professional personnel within the classroom, library, hallway,
lunchroom, gymnasium, school building, school grounds or wherever
supervision is required. For purposes of this section, "under the direct supervision of certificated professional personnel" means
that certificated professional personnel is present, with and
accompanying the aide.

(11) Effective the first day of July, two thousand two,
a
service personnel employee employed ten or more years
shall be
raised one pay grade above the pay grade held at that time.

(12) Effective the first day of July, two thousand two, a
service personnel employee holding an H pay grade
with ten or more
years of employment shall receive an increase of thirty dollars per
month.

NOTE: The purpose of this bill is to increase school service
personnel employees by one pay grade after ten years of employment.
Those employees in the top pay grade will receive an increase of
$30 per month after ten years of employment.
